The Minnesota Vikings are set to take on their heated division rival in the Green Bay Packers.
It's a crucial game for the Vikings, as they have a chance at the number one seed in the NFC and the NFC North division crown. The Packers are locked into a wild card spot but could potentially overtake the number five seed from the Vikings with two wins and two Vikings losses.
Even without the biggest stakes for the Packers, they will still get up for the game, as it's a nationally televised game against a division rival, which will also make the game easier to watch across the country.
How to watch the Packers vs. Vikings in market
After initially being scheduled to be at noon, the National Football League made the move to flex the game into the 3:25 window and replaced the Philadelphia Eagles taking on the Dallas Cowboys, which was moved into the noon time slot. The number one broadcast team of Kevin Burkhardt, Tom Brady, Erin Andrews and Tom Rinaldi will be on the call.
How to watch the Packers vs. Vikings out of market
The game will have the number one broadcast team which means that it will be shown in every market nationwide.
Vikings radio coverage
The Vikings are lucky enough to have the best radio broadcaster in the world Paul Allen. He will be on the call with former Vikings linebacker Pete Bercich on 100.3 KFAN.
